Lemon Garlic Butter Salmon in Foil with Pineapple
Ingredients:
- 2 salmon fillets
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 lemon, sliced
- 1 cup fresh pineapple chunks
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Prepare a large piece of aluminum foil, enough to wrap around the salmon fillets and pineapple.
2. Place the salmon fillets on the center of the foil. Drizzle the olive oil and melted butter over them. Sprinkle the minced garlic, salt, and pepper on top.
3. Layer the lemon slices over the salmon, and arrange the pineapple chunks around them.
4. Fold the sides of the foil over the salmon and pineapple, creating a sealed packet to trap the steam.
5. Place the foil packet on a baking sheet and bake for 15-20 minutes, or until the salmon is cooked through and flakes easily with a fork.
6. Carefully open the foil packet (watch out for steam!) and transfer the salmon and pineapple to a plate. Drizzle some juices from the packet over the top for extra flavor.
7. Garnish with chopped fresh parsley before serving.
Notes:
Enjoy this dish with a side of rice or a fresh salad for a complete meal. Adjust the amount of garlic and lemon to suit your taste!
